2. Investment Income
Investing your retirement savings can provide a steady stream of income. Here are some investment options to consider:
-
Stocks and Bonds: These can provide income through dividends and interest payments.
-
Real Estate: Owning rental properties can generate rental income.
-
Peer-to-Peer Lending: Platforms like Prosper and Lending Club allow you to lend money to individuals and earn interest.
-
Dividend Stocks: Companies that pay dividends can provide a regular income stream.
3. Part-Time Work
Engaging in part-time work can provide additional income and keep you socially active. Consider the following options:
-
Freelancing: Use your skills and expertise to offer services to clients.
-
Consulting: Share your knowledge and experience with businesses in need of your expertise.
-
Teaching or Tutoring: If you have a passion for teaching, consider teaching or tutoring online or in person.
-
Seasonal Work: Many industries offer seasonal work opportunities, such as retail or tourism.
